Category: PAINTING

I am a plein-air painter who just sees things a little differently!
I always start outside, sketching or painting quickly on either boards, panels, cardboard or paper. I am looking for form and color and trying to narrow in on just what is exciting about what I am seeing. Then when I get into my studio I start thinking about the edges of what I saw and how they intersected with their backgrounds. I crank up my music, get myself back into that space outside and have at it.
Almost all of my paintings are painted ala-prima or at 'one go' and often the first painting leads to another as I begin to wonder 'what would happen if?
My painting style is as you see here loose, impressionistic and full of color. I hope you enjoy my vision of California.

Leslie Hailey Hurst is a painter, cattlewoman and olive grower; She earned her Bachelor of Fine Arts from Washington State University and then raised children and cows for 30 years.; When they finally left home (the children; not the cows!) she started to paint again. She is primarily a landscape painter; and found her third occupation while painting landscapes in Italy.; While there she found that she fell in love with olive groves and soon realized that the ground on her ranch was very similar to the Mediterranean soil. She came home and planted 600 Italian varital olive trees. Her olive company, Woods Creek Olive Oil and her cattle company, Table Mountain Beef featuring niche-marketed, no hormone/no antibiotic, grass and grain fed beef do quite well, offering her the time and space to explore her art. Leslie currently resides on her ranch in Jamestown, California.
